As there are no dealers with a sample of the Bav 30 in central Canada, I'm flying to Boston the end of September to view one at the In Water Boat Show. There is already a full range of comments available on Bavaria value, build quality and misplaced keels. Based on photos and specifications the features/price may be appropriate for my cruising and JAM racing needs.

There are two issues. The 30 has no traveller, but rather a control harness forward of the main hatch. Secondly, my local area makes attractive a more shallow draft and this option on the 30 yields a sort of tandem keel joined by a bulb.

What are the performance characteristics of these two design features? the other boat on the current short list is a Catalina 309 with a traveller on the roof and a wing keel; known locally as the danforth keel. Can I expect similar performance to that with the Catalina traveller/keel combination?
